The São Paulo Business Landscape
São Paulo's Faria Lima and Paulista corridors are synonymous with Brazilian finance and corporate activity. The city is also home to a booming tech sector centered in neighborhoods like Vila Olímpia and Itaim Bibi. Startups and scaleups in fintech, healthtech, and SaaS are scaling rapidly, and their founders face constant pressure to do more with less.
Beyond the corporate core, São Paulo's diverse economy includes a massive wholesale and retail trade network, one of the largest fashion industries in the Americas, and a growing creative economy. Business owners across all these verticals share a common challenge: administrative and operational tasks eat into time that could be spent on revenue-generating activities.
The city's international character also means many São Paulo businesses operate in multiple languages and across multiple time zones, making remote support from skilled virtual assistants especially valuable.

Why Hire a Virtual Assistant Instead of Local Staff?
Hiring full-time employees in Brazil comes with significant regulatory complexity. Brazil's CLT labor law framework means employers must account for FGTS contributions, 13th-month salary, vacation pay, health benefits, and other mandatory costs that can add 60–80% on top of a base salary. For small business owners and startups, this overhead is a serious barrier to growth.
Virtual assistants, especially those hired through international service platforms, offer a cost-effective alternative. You get skilled, dedicated support without the regulatory burden and overhead of a local hire. You can scale your VA support up or down based on business needs, and you're not locked into long-term employment contracts.
For São Paulo businesses that operate internationally, English-speaking VAs also provide a seamless bridge between local operations and global partners, investors, or clients.
